Eggless Churro Pancakes

Eggless Churro Pancakes

These eggless churro pancakes bring comforting dessert-inspired flavor to breakfast. They are a delightful treat worth sharing with family.
Prep Time 15 minutes
Cook Time 13 minutes
Total Time 28 minutes
Servings: 4 servings
Course: Breakfast
Cuisine: American
Calories: 671

Ingredients
  

For the Pancakes
  • 1 1/2 cups All Purpose Flour
  • 2 tbsp Granulated Sugar
  • 2 tsp Baking Powder
  • 1/2 tsp Baking Soda
  • 1 tsp Ground Cinnamon
  • 1/4 tsp Salt
  • 1 1/4 cups Buttermilk
  • 3 tbsp Melted Butter
  • 1 tsp Vanilla Extract
For the Cinnamon Sugar Coating
  • 1/2 cup Granulated Sugar
  • 1 tbsp Ground Cinnamon
  • 4 tbsp Melted Butter
For the Chocolate Sauce
  • 1/2 cup Chocolate Chips
  • 1/4 cup Heavy Cream

Equipment

  • griddle
  • pastry brush

Method
 

  1. Stir the 1/2 cup sugar and 1 tablespoon cinnamon together in a shallow dish for the coating. Keep the 4 tablespoons of melted butter nearby with a pastry brush.
  2. Whisk together the flour, sugar, baking powder, baking soda, cinnamon, and salt in a large bowl.
  3. Whisk the buttermilk, melted butter, and vanilla, then stir into the dry ingredients just until combined. Rest the batter 5 minutes.
  4. Cook 1/4 cup portions on a greased griddle over medium heat until bubbles form, then flip and cook until golden on both sides.
  5. Heat the cream until steaming, about 45 seconds in the microwave, and pour it over the chocolate chips. Let sit 1 minute, then stir until smooth and glossy.
  6. While the pancakes are still warm, brush both sides with melted butter and press into the cinnamon sugar until fully coated.
  7. Stack and serve with the warm chocolate sauce for dipping or drizzling, just like fresh churros at a fair.
